In message <16826.45612.44509.939434@ran.psg.com>, Randy Bush writes: > DUMP: 11.73% done, finished in 0:37 at Sat Dec 11 08:39:42 2004 > DUMP: 22.67% done, finished in 0:34 at Sat Dec 11 08:41:12 2004 > DUMP: 32.96% done, finished in 0:30 at Sat Dec 11 08:42:36 2004 > DUMP: 43.35% done, finished in 0:26 at Sat Dec 11 08:43:14 2004 > DUMP: 54.40% done, finished in 0:20 at Sat Dec 11 08:43:03 2004 > DUMP: 65.30% done, finished in 0:15 at Sat Dec 11 08:43:02 2004 > DUMP: 76.38% done, finished in 0:10 at Sat Dec 11 08:42:55 2004 > DUMP: 88.74% done, finished in 0:05 at Sat Dec 11 08:42:10 2004 > >notice that the time of day is descending! That's not the time of day, that's the estimated completion time. -- Poul-Henning Kamp | UNIX since Zilog Zeus 3.20 phk@FreeBSD.ORG | TCP/IP since RFC 956 FreeBSD committer | BSD since 4.3-tahoe Never attribute to malice what can adequately be explained by incompetence.
